One key component of a freezer that often goes unnoticed is the door seal. Proper maintenance of the door seal is essential to ensure optimal performance and energy efficiency. Importance of Door Seal Maintenance: Preserves Food Freshness: A tight and secure door seal prevents cold air from escaping, maintaining a consistent temperature inside the freezer and preserving the freshness of stored food items. Energy Efficiency: A damaged or loose door seal can lead to energy wastage as the freezer works harder to maintain the desired temperature. Regular maintenance helps improve energy efficiency and reduce electricity bills. Prevents Frost Build-up: An effective door seal prevents moisture from entering the freezer, reducing the chances of frost build-up. This not only helps maintain the quality of the frozen food but also ensures efficient operation of the appliance. Extended Lifespan: Proper maintenance of the door seal can extend the lifespan of the freezer, ensuring that it continues to function effectively for years to come. Importance of Maintaining Your Dryer Regular maintenance of your dryer can help prevent costly repairs and prolong its lifespan. A well-maintained dryer operates more efficiently, saving you time and energy. Clean dryers reduce the risk of fire hazards, ensuring the safety of your home and family. Proper care of your dryer can also contribute to better air quality in your laundry room. It is essential to follow these simple steps to keep your dryer in top condition: 1. Clean the Lint Filter Regularly Removing lint from the filter after each use is vital to prevent blockages and improve airflow. Clogged filters can cause your dryer to overheat and increase the risk of a fire hazard. 2. Inspect and Clean the Venting System Check the venting system for any blockages or obstructions and clean it at least once a year. A clear venting system ensures proper air circulation and efficient drying cycles. 3. Avoid Overloading the Dryer While it may be tempting to fit more clothes into one load, overloading the dryer can strain the appliance and lead to uneven drying. Follow the manufacturer's recommendations for the maximum load capacity. 4. Schedule Professional Maintenance Regular maintenance by a professional technician can help identify potential issues early on and prevent costly repairs down the line. Consider scheduling annual maintenance checks to keep your dryer in optimal condition. Tips to Prevent Bad Odors in Your Appliances Clean your refrigerator regularly by removing expired food items and wiping down shelves and drawers with a mixture of water and vinegar. For stoves and cooktops, remove any food residue immediately after cooking to prevent odors from lingering. A mix of baking soda and water can be used to scrub away stubborn stains. Ensure your dishwasher is clean by running an empty cycle with a dishwasher cleaner or a cup of vinegar to eliminate any build-up of food particles and bacteria. For washers and dryers, clean the lint trap in the dryer after each use and run a hot cycle with white vinegar in the washer to prevent mold and mildew growth. Preventative Maintenance Tips Here are some essential maintenance tips to help you keep your dishwasher in top condition: Regularly clean the filter to prevent clogs and ensure proper drainage. Inspect and clean the spray arms to remove any debris that may affect water flow. Check the door gasket for any signs of wear and tear and replace it if necessary to prevent leaks. Run an empty cycle with vinegar to remove any built-up mineral deposits and odors. The Importance of Cleaning Your Dryer's Lint Filter Prevents Fire Hazards: Lint buildup in the filter and dryer vent can easily ignite, causing a dangerous fire hazard. Regular cleaning reduces the risk of fire, protecting your home and family. Improves Efficiency: A clogged lint filter restricts airflow, making your dryer work harder and less efficiently. Cleaning the lint filter helps maintain proper airflow, reducing energy consumption and drying time. Extends Dryer Lifespan: By cleaning the lint filter regularly, you can prolong the lifespan of your dryer. A well-maintained dryer functions more effectively and is less likely to break down prematurely. Enhances Clothing Care: Lint buildup on the filter can transfer back onto your clothes, affecting their cleanliness and causing potential damage. Cleaning the lint filter ensures your clothes stay fresh and lint-free. To maintain the efficiency and safety of your dryer, it is recommended to clean the lint filter after each use. Additionally, scheduling professional dryer vent cleaning annually can further reduce fire hazards and improve the performance of your dryer.
